function cdtime(container, targetdate){
if (!document.getElementById || !document.getElementById(container)) return
this.container=document.getElementById(container)
this.currentTime=new Date()
this.targetdate=new Date(targetdate)
this.timesup=false
this.updateTime()
}

cdtime.prototype.updateTime=function(){
var thisobj=this
this.currentTime.setSeconds(this.currentTime.getSeconds()+1)
setTimeout(function(){thisobj.updateTime()}, 1000)
}

cdtime.prototype.displaycountdown=function(baseunit, functionref){
this.baseunit=baseunit
this.formatresults=functionref
this.showresults()
}

cdtime.prototype.showresults=function(){
var thisobj=this


var timediff=(this.targetdate-this.currentTime)/1000
if (timediff<0){
this.timesup=true
this.container.innerHTML=this.formatresults()
return
}
var oneMinute=60
var oneHour=60*60
var oneDay=60*60*24
var dayfield=Math.floor(timediff/oneDay)
var hourfield=Math.floor((timediff-dayfield*oneDay)/oneHour)
var minutefield=Math.floor((timediff-dayfield*oneDay-hourfield*oneHour)/oneMinute)
var secondfield=Math.floor((timediff-dayfield*oneDay-hourfield*oneHour-minutefield*oneMinute))
if (hourfield<10) hourfield="0"+hourfield
if (minutefield<10) minutefield="0"+minutefield
if (secondfield<10) secondfield="0"+secondfield
this.container.innerHTML=this.formatresults(dayfield, hourfield, minutefield, secondfield)
setTimeout(function(){thisobj.showresults()}, 1000)
}

function fesztf1(){
if (this.timesup==false){
var displaystring='<table><tbody><tr class="cdlogo"><td colspan="4"><img src="http://beindulo.hu/wp-content/themes/beindulo2/kep/countdown-sziget.png" alt="Sziget Fesztivál"/></td></tr>'
displaystring+='<tr class="cdszamok"><td>'+arguments[0]+'</td><td>'+arguments[1]+'</td><td>'+arguments[2]+'</td><td>'+arguments[3]+'</td></tr>'
displaystring+='<tr class="cdszoveg"><td>nap</td><td>óra</td><td>perc</td><td>mp</td></tr></tbody></table>'
}
else{
var displaystring='<table><tbody><tr class="cdlogo"><td><img src="http://beindulo.hu/wp-content/themes/beindulo2/kep/countdown-sziget.png" alt="Sziget Fesztivál"/></td></tr>'
displaystring+='<tr class="cdkezd"><td>Elkezdődött!</td></tr>'
displaystring+='<tr class="cdszoveg"><td>augusztus 12-17.</td></tr></tbody></table>'
}
return displaystring
}

function fesztf2(){
if (this.timesup==false){
var displaystring='<table><tbody><tr class="cdlogo"><td colspan="4"><img src="http://beindulo.hu/wp-content/themes/beindulo2/kep/countdown-hegyalja.png" alt="Hegyalja Fesztivál"/></td></tr>'
displaystring+='<tr class="cdszamok"><td>'+arguments[0]+'</td><td>'+arguments[1]+'</td><td>'+arguments[2]+'</td><td>'+arguments[3]+'</td></tr>'
displaystring+='<tr class="cdszoveg"><td>nap</td><td>óra</td><td>perc</td><td>mp</td></tr></tbody></table>'
}
else{
var displaystring='<table><tbody><tr class="cdlogo"><td><img src="http://beindulo.hu/wp-content/themes/beindulo2/kep/countdown-hegyalja.png" alt="Hegyalja Fesztivál"/></td></tr>'
displaystring+='<tr class="cdkezd"><td>Elkezdődött!</td></tr>'
displaystring+='<tr class="cdszoveg"><td>július 15-19.</td></tr></tbody></table>'
}
return displaystring
}

function fesztf3(){
if (this.timesup==false){
var displaystring='<table><tbody><tr class="cdlogo"><td colspan="4"><img src="http://beindulo.hu/wp-content/themes/beindulo2/kep/countdown-efott.png" alt="EFOTT"/></td></tr>'
displaystring+='<tr class="cdszamok"><td>'+arguments[0]+'</td><td>'+arguments[1]+'</td><td>'+arguments[2]+'</td><td>'+arguments[3]+'</td></tr>'
displaystring+='<tr class="cdszoveg"><td>nap</td><td>óra</td><td>perc</td><td>mp</td></tr></tbody></table>'
}
else{
var displaystring='<table><tbody><tr class="cdlogo"><td><img src="http://beindulo.hu/wp-content/themes/beindulo2/kep/countdown-efott.png" alt="EFOTT"/></td></tr>'
displaystring+='<tr class="cdkezd"><td>Elkezdődött!</td></tr>'
displaystring+='<tr class="cdszoveg"><td>július 14-19.</td></tr></tbody></table>'
}
return displaystring
}

function fesztf4(){
if (this.timesup==false){
var displaystring='<table><tbody><tr class="cdlogo"><td colspan="4"><img src="http://beindulo.hu/wp-content/themes/beindulo2/kep/countdown-balatonsound.png" alt="Balaton Sound"/></td></tr>'
displaystring+='<tr class="cdszamok"><td>'+arguments[0]+'</td><td>'+arguments[1]+'</td><td>'+arguments[2]+'</td><td>'+arguments[3]+'</td></tr>'
displaystring+='<tr class="cdszoveg"><td>nap</td><td>óra</td><td>perc</td><td>mp</td></tr></tbody></table>'
}
else{
var displaystring='<table><tbody><tr class="cdlogo"><td><img src="http://beindulo.hu/wp-content/themes/beindulo2/kep/countdown-balatonsound.png" alt="Balaton Sound"/></td></tr>'
displaystring+='<tr class="cdkezd"><td>Elkezdődött!</td></tr>'
displaystring+='<tr class="cdszoveg"><td>július 9-12.</td></tr></tbody></table>'
}
return displaystring
}